Open up operaprefs.ini (in the profile folder) and look for "Level Of Update Automation=" and "Auto Update State=" and set them both to =0 if they're not already.
See if that fixes it. If not it may be that your installation is corrupted somehow, in which case rename operaprefs.ini to operaprefs.old and see if Opera will then start with a clean default setup.
